Output 668dec53aef168c70f5fc3a7051aef61b261f97e35ed38497690d641d6559d6e:0

value
3501324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b1ddf8b9d4a69e77c8a77a5ef48d188a2b6bb2 OP_EQUAL
address
3QBRE9xFFpML2J6zVeZLu5UFLE4qe5LrFa
transaction
668dec53aef168c70f5fc3a7051aef61b261f97e35ed38497690d641d6559d6e
spent
true